Sunan Ibn Majah 4258 (Book 37, Hadith 159) #33614
Remembering Death

SUMMARY: Death is inevitable and should be remembered often.

It was narrated that Abu Hurairah said: "The Messenger of Allah said: 'Frequently remember the destroyer of pleasures,’ meaning death".
حَدَّثَنَا مَحْمُودُ بْنُ غَيْلاَنَ، حَدَّثَنَا الْفَضْلُ بْنُ مُوسَى، عَنْ مُحَمَّدِ بْنِ عَمْرٍو، عَنْ أَبِي سَلَمَةَ، عَنْ أَبِي هُرَيْرَةَ، قَالَ قَالَ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 ـ ـ ‏:‏ ‏ "‏ أَكْثِرُوا ذِكْرَ هَاذِمِ اللَّذَّاتِ ‏"‏ ‏.‏ يَعْنِي الْمَوْتَ

EXPLANATIONS:
The hadith narrated by Abu Hurairah states that the Prophet Muhammad said to remember death frequently. This means that we should not forget about death and its inevitability, as it will eventually come for us all. We should remember this fact in order to live our lives in a way that pleases Allah, as we know our time on earth is limited. We should also use this knowledge to stay away from worldly pleasures and focus on the afterlife instead. This hadith serves as a reminder of how important it is to keep death in mind when making decisions or engaging in activities, so that we can make sure they are pleasing to Allah and beneficial for us in the hereafter.
